Output 2b50e71b7598bbefa61bf142c51242417dbc6425459ef0fdc04e248ba7a39f86:0

value
1454141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f4f5a500710a122835baf6cb03660da97a24f52 OP_EQUAL
address
37TmZA4rboLJrFZX1Ekaq1EfwynKvbozHW
transaction
2b50e71b7598bbefa61bf142c51242417dbc6425459ef0fdc04e248ba7a39f86
spent
true